If the cell is placed into a hypotonic solution, the amount of salt (or sugar) will be lower, and water will move into the cell, and it will swell. Water will move from a lower concentration of water to a higher to reach a balance. The opposite will be true for hypertonic solutions, the cell will lose water. They appear crenate or serrated.
